ABCD is trapezium with AB // DC. A line parallel to AC intersects AB at point M and BC at point N. Prove that: area of Δ ADM = area of Δ ACN.

Answer

Given: ABCD is a trapezium

Ans 15 Exercise - 16 A Area Theorem Concise Class-9th Selina ICSE Maths

AB || CD, MN || AC

Join C and M

We know that area of triangles on the same base and between same parallel lines are equal.

So Area of Δ AMD = Area of Δ AMC

Similarly, consider AMNC quadrilateral where MN || AC.

Δ ACM and Δ ACN are on the same base and between the same parallel lines. So areas are equal.

So, Area of Δ ACM = Area of Δ CAN

From the above two equations, we can say

Area of Δ ADM = Area of Δ CAN

Hence Proved.

In the given figure, AD // BE // CF. Prove that area (ΔAEC) = area (ΔDBF)

…………..

Answer

We know that area of triangles on the same base and between same parallel lines are equal.

Consider ABED quadrilateral; AD||BE

With common base, BE and between AD and BE parallel lines, we have

Area of ΔABE = Area of ΔBDE

Similarly, in BEFC quadrilateral, BE||CF

With common base BC and between BE and CF parallel lines, we have

Area of ΔBEC = Area of ΔBEF

Adding both equations, we have

Area of ΔABE + Area of ΔBEC = Area of ΔBEF + Area of ΔBDE

=> Area of AEC = Area of DBF

Hence Proved

In the given figure, ABCD is a parallelogram; BC is produced to point X. Prove that: area (Δ ABX) = area (quad. ACXD)

………………

Answer

Given: ABCD is a parallelogram.

We know that

Area of ΔABC = Area of ΔACD

Consider ΔABX,

Area of ΔABX = Area of ΔABC + Area of ΔACX

We also know that area of triangles on the same base and between same parallel lines are equal.

Area of ΔACX = Area of ΔCXD

From above equations, we can conclude that

Area of ΔABX = Area of ΔABC + Area of ΔACX = Area of ΔACD+ Area of ΔCXD = Area of ACXD Quadrilateral

Hence Proved

In the given figure; AD is median of ΔABC and E is any point on median AD. Prove that Area (ΔABE) = Area (ΔACE).

Answer

AD is the median of ΔABC. Therefore it will divide ΔABC into two triangles of equal areas.

Area(ΔABD)= Area(ΔACD)   (i)

ED is the median of EBC

Area(ΔEBD)= Area(ΔECD)  (ii)

Subtracting equation (ii) from (i), we obtain

Area(ΔABD)- Area(ΔEBD)= Area(ΔACD)- Area(ΔECD)

Area (ΔABE) = Area (ΔACE). Hence proved

The medians of a triangle ABC intersect each other at point G. If one of its medians is AD, prove that:

(i) Area (ΔABD) = 3 Area (ΔBGD)

(ii) Area (ΔACD) = 3 Area (CGD)

(iii) Area (ΔBGC) = 1/3 Area (ΔABC)

Answer

 The figure is shown below

(i) Medians intersect at centroid.
Given that C is the point of intersection of medians and hence G is the centroid of the triangle ABC.

Centroid divides the medians in the ratio 2: 1
That is AG: GD = 2: 1.

Since BG divides AD in the ratio 2: 1, we have,

⇒ Area( ΔAGB ) = 2Area( ΔBGD )

From the figure, it is clear that,
Area( ΔABD ) = Area( ΔAGB ) + Area( ΔBGD )

⇒ Area( ΔABD ) = 2Area( ΔBGD ) + Area( ΔBGD )
⇒ Area( ΔABD ) = 3Area( ΔBGD )        ……(1)

(ii) Medians intersect at centroid.
Given that G is the point of intersection of medians and hence G is the centroid of the triangle ABC.

Centroid divides the medians in the ratio 2: 1
That is AG: GD = 2: 1.

Since CG divides AD in the ratio 2: 1, we have,
A( ΔAGC )/A( ΔCGD)=2/1

⇒ Area( ΔAGC ) = 2Area( ΔCGD )

From the figure, it is clear that,
Area( ΔACD ) = Area( ΔAGC ) + Area( ΔCGD )
⇒ Area( ΔACD ) = 2Area( ΔCGD ) + Area( ΔCGD )
⇒ Area( ΔACD ) = 3Area( ΔCGD )        ……(2)

(iii) Adding equations (1) and (2), We have,
Area( ΔABD ) + Area( ΔACD ) = 3Area( ΔBGD ) + 3Area( ΔCGD )
⇒ Area( ΔABC ) = 3[ Area( ΔBGD ) + Area( ΔCGD ) ]
⇒ Area( ΔABC ) = 3[ Area( ΔBGC ) ]

ABCD is a trapezium with AB parallel to DC. A line parallel to AC intersects AB at X and BC at Y. Prove that area of ∆ADX = area of ∆ACY.

Answer

Join CX, DX and AY.

Ans 11 Exercise - 16 C Area Theorem Concise Class-9th Selina ICSE Maths

Now, triangles ADX and ACX are on the same base AX and between the parallels AB and DC.

∴ A(ΔADX) = A(ΔACX) ….(i)

Also, triangles ACX and ACY are on the same base AC and between the parallels AC and XY.

∴ A(ΔACX) = A(ΔACY) ….(ii)

From (i) and (ii), we get

A(ΔADX) = A(ΔACY)
